Range and Efficiency
Although both cars have the same battery capacity, Hyundai Ioniq 5 Project 45 (2021) achieves a longer real-world range due to its superior energy efficiency.

Charging
The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Project 45 (2021) features an advanced 800-volt architecture, whereas the MG Marvel R Performance (2021-…) relies on a standard 400-volt system.
The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Project 45 (2021) offers faster charging speeds at DC stations, reaching up to 221 kW, while the MG Marvel R Performance (2021-…) maxes out at 94 kW.
Both vehicles are equipped with the same on-board charger, supporting a maximum AC charging power of 11 kW.

Cargo and Towing
The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Project 45 (2021) provides more cargo capacity, featuring both a larger trunk and more space with the rear seats folded.
A frunk (front trunk) is available in the Hyundai Ioniq 5 Project 45 (2021), but the MG Marvel R Performance (2021-…) doesn’t have one.
The Hyundai Ioniq 5 Project 45 (2021) is better suited for heavy loads, offering a greater towing capacity than the MG Marvel R Performance (2021-…).
